How to use this list
- Shortlist 2–3 firms that fit your category and campaign tempo.
- Run a 6–8 week pilot with clear CAC/LTV hypotheses and platform splits (Reels/Shorts/Moj/Josh/ShareChat).
- Lock a 3–6 month retainer only after cohorts and content angles prove repeatable.
What should Indian D2C brands look for in a creator-first partner?
- Category-market fit: Look for measurable wins in your category (skincare, nutraceuticals, home, electronics), with ASCI-compliant claims.
- Measurement maturity: Insist on commerce-aligned KPIs (CAC, new-to-file, assisted conversions), UTM/coupon discipline, and click-to-chat routing via WhatsApp.
- Always-on content systems: Ask for a monthly content OS with formats for Instagram Reels, YouTube Shorts, Moj/Josh hooks, and ShareChat vernacular adaptations.
- Community feedback loops: Creators should feed VOC (voice of customer) insights to refine PDPs, landing pages, and FAQ objections.
- Compliance and safety: Strong brand safety filters, fact-checking, and ASCI disclosures implemented natively per platform.
- Platform footprint: Ability to activate on LinkedIn for B2B buyers (if relevant) and WhatsApp for catalog and retargeting flows.

How much does a creator-first brand strategy cost in India?
Indicative INR ranges for D2C brands (actuals vary by category, creator tiers, and seasonality):
- Pilot (6–8 weeks, micro/mid-tier mix): ₹10–25 lakh
- Always-on monthly retainer (strategy + content + ops): ₹4–15 lakh/month
- Scale burst (national moment like IPL/Diwali): ₹30 lakh–₹1.5 crore
- Marquee talent/IP collaborations: ₹75 lakh–₹3 crore+
Cost drivers
- Creator tiers (nano/micro vs. top-tier), deliverables per creator, and usage rights.
- Platform mix and paid support (boosting on Reels/Shorts, YouTube Mastheads, LinkedIn ads).
- Complexities like multilingual shoots, regional travel, or co-created product drops.
Practical tip: Keep 15–30% of spend for paid amplification to stabilise reach variability.
How do creator-led strategies drive measurable growth for D2C?
- Content-to-commerce stitching: Conversions rise when creators handle objections (ingredients, warranty, fit) and streamline CTAs to PDPs or WhatsApp chat.
- Moment marketing: IPL, Prime Day-style sales, festive peaks (Onam, Durga Puja, Diwali), and wedding season can multiply conversion if inventory and logistics are synced.
- Vernacular expansion: Moj, Josh, and ShareChat unlock Tier 2/3 scale with region-first formats and creator credibility.
- Retention loops: Creator-exclusive couponing and post-purchase UGC keep CAC efficient while nudging LTV via bundles and subscriptions.

Q: What budget should I plan for a Diwali or IPL creator burst? Brands typically earmark ₹30 lakh–₹1.5 crore depending on creator tiers, platform mix, and paid amplification. Lock inventory and creators 6–8 weeks early to avoid surge pricing and secure exclusive angles.
Q: How fast can I see ROI from a creator-first program? Most D2C pilots show directional CAC/LTV signals within 4–6 weeks when UTMs, coupons, and retargeting are correctly set. Durable efficiency usually emerges by Month 3 once top-performing creators and hooks are scaled.
Q: Do I need Moj, Josh, and ShareChat if I already win on Instagram? Yes if you want Tier 2/3 depth, vernacular relevance, and incremental reach at lower CPMs. Use platform-native hooks and creators instead of reposts; treat each as a distinct channel with tailored briefs and metrics.
